📖 English Meaning
And it is He who sends down rain from the sky, and We produce thereby the growth of all things. We produce from it greenery from which We produce grains arranged in layers. And from the palm trees - of its emerging fruit are clusters hanging low. And [We produce] gardens of grapevines and olives and pomegranates, similar yet varied. Look at [each of] its fruit when it yields and [at] its ripening. Indeed in that are signs for a people who believe.

Translation — Tafsir

Word Meanings:

  • Mā’ (ماء): Rainwater sent down from the sky.
  • Khaḍiran (خَضِرًا): Green vegetation, fresh and moist plants.
  • Ḥabban mutarākiban (حَبًّا مُّتَرَاكِبًا): Grains stacked upon one another, like the kernels in ears of wheat, barley, and similar crops.
  • Ṭalʿihā (طَلْعِهَا): The first emergence of the date-palm fruit, the spathe from which the clusters sprout.
  • Qinwān (قِنْوَانٌ): Clusters or bunches of dates; the plural of qinw (a date cluster).
  • Dāniyah (دَانِيَةٌ): Low-hanging, within easy reach of both the standing and the seated.
  • Yanʿih (يَنْعِهِ): Its ripening and full maturity, when the fruit becomes sweet, beneficial, and ready to be enjoyed.

Tafsir (Explanation):

It is Allah—and He alone—who sends down rain from the sky, and by that water He brings forth every kind of plant and vegetation. From that green growth, He produces grains that pile up in layers within their ears, like the kernels of wheat, barley, and rice. From the spathe of the date-palm, He brings forth clusters of dates hanging low, so near that anyone—whether standing or sitting—can easily reach them. He also grows vineyards of grapes, and olive and pomegranate trees, whose leaves resemble one another but whose fruits differ in taste, shape, and nature.

Look, O people, with your own eyes at this fruit when it first appears—small, hard, and seemingly of little use—and then behold it as it ripens and matures, becoming large, sweet, and nourishing. Reflect on how this transformation happens, stage by stage, by the will of the One who has no partner. Indeed, in all of this are clear signs and undeniable proofs of Allah’s perfect power, wisdom, and mercy—for people who truly believe, for it is faith that opens the heart to see the Creator’s hand in every leaf, every drop of rain, and every ripening fruit.

These verses call you to pause and marvel: the same rain that falls on barren land brings forth gardens of every kind; the same earth that seems dead bursts into life at His command. If you ponder this, you will realize that the One who can bring life from dry soil is also able to bring you back after death, to reward the believer and hold the disbeliever to account. So let this reflection increase your faith, deepen your gratitude, and draw you closer to your Lord, who has placed these signs before you out of His immense mercy—so that you may know Him, worship Him alone, and live in obedience to His guidance. Indeed, in these wonders are lessons for every heart that seeks the truth and every soul that yearns for its Creator.
